diff options
Diffstat (limited to 'installer')
| -rw-r--r-- | installer/installer.pro | 2 | ||||
| -rw-r--r-- | installer/main.cpp | 7 |
2 files changed, 8 insertions, 1 deletions
diff --git a/installer/installer.pro b/installer/installer.pro index 4f1ae16..2ab71aa 100644 --- a/installer/installer.pro +++ b/installer/installer.pro @@ -8,7 +8,7 @@ QT += core gui network svg winextras CONFIG += static INCLUDEPATH += "C:/Program Files (x86)/zlib/include" -LIBS += -L"C:/Program Files (x86)/zlib/lib" -lzlibstat +LIBS += -L"C:/Program Files (x86)/zlib/lib" -lzlibstat -llegacy_stdio_definitions DEFINES += QUAZIP_STATIC ZLIB_WINAPI greaterThan(QT_MAJOR_VERSION, 4): QT += widgets diff --git a/installer/main.cpp b/installer/main.cpp index a36d8a5..8507180 100644 --- a/installer/main.cpp +++ b/installer/main.cpp @@ -10,6 +10,13 @@ #include <QMessageBox> #include <QDesktopWidget> +FILE _iob[] = {*stdin, *stdout, *stderr}; + +extern "C" FILE * __cdecl __iob_func(void) +{ + return _iob; +} + int main(int argc, char *argv[]) { QApplication a(argc, argv); |
